Crooklets reveals itself as a rugged fringe of the Cornish coast, where the salt-heavy air clarifies the edges of every stone and blade of grass. It lies 0.4 miles north-west of Bude (from Bude: bearing 321°T, OS grid SS 204 071). The landscape here is defined by the persistent dialogue between the Atlantic swell and the jagged rock, an encounter that keeps the horizon in constant, shifting motion. Crooklets Beach anchors the western edge, offering a wide expanse of sand that draws the eye toward the horizon with a cold, pale intensity. Nearby, the Bude Coast Sssi protects the fragile geology of these cliffs, preserving a terrain that seems to have been carved by the wind’s own patient hand. Inland, the gentle flow of Crooklets Stream provides a quiet counterpoint to the thunder of the waves, winding its way through the verdant margins of the coast.
